Summit Entertainment has released the first trailer for the sci-fi thrillerKin, and it looks like a pretty interesting Amblin throwback. Directed by brothersJonathanandJosh Bakerand based on their short filmBag Man, the film starsMyles Truittas a young boy who finds a mysterious alien weapon and is then forced to go on the run with his ex-con brother (Jack Reynor) when a vengeful criminal (James Franco) puts a target on their backs.

Here’s the official synopsis forKin:
KIN, a pulse-pounding crime thriller with a sci-fi twist, is the story of an unexpected hero destined for greatness. Chased by a vengeful criminal (James Franco) and a gang of otherworldly soldiers, a recently released ex-con (Jack Reynor) and his adopted teenage brother (Myles Truitt) are forced to go on the run with a weapon of mysterious origin as their only protection.
